@ngx-loading-bar/http
Version:
Automatic page loading / progress bar for Angular
12 lines (11 loc) • 600 B
TypeScript
import { LoadingBarService } from '@ngx-loading-bar/core';
import { ConnectionBackend, Http, Request, RequestOptions, RequestOptionsArgs, Response } from '@angular/http';
import { Observable } from 'rxjs';
export interface LoadingBarRequestOptionsArgs extends RequestOptionsArgs {
ignoreLoadingBar?: boolean;
}
export declare class LoadingBarHttp extends Http {
private loadingBar;
constructor(_backend: ConnectionBackend, _defaultOptions: RequestOptions, loadingBar: LoadingBarService);
request(url: string | Request, options?: LoadingBarRequestOptionsArgs): Observable<Response>;
}